( 10 ?6 /c) category temperature range (c) erj1rh (0201) 0.05 15 30 0.5 1 k to 1 m (e24, e96) 50 ?55 to +125 erj2rh (0402) 0.063 50 100 0.5 100 to 100 k (e24, e96) 50 ?55 to +125 erj2rk (0402) 0.063 50 100 0.5 10 to 97.6 102 k to 1 m (e24, e96) 100 ?55 to +125 erj3rb (0603) 0.1 50 100 0.5 100 to 100 k (e24, e96) 50 ?55 to +125 erj3re (0603) 0.1 50 100 0.5 10 to 97.6 102 k to 1 m (e24, e96) 100 ?55 to +125 erj6rb (0805) 0.1 150 200 0.5 100 to 100 k (e24, e96) 50 ?55 to +125 erj6re (0805) 0.1 150 200 0.5 10 to 97.6 102 k to 1 m (e24, e96) 100 ?55 to +125 (1) rated continuous working voltage (rcwv) shall be de ter mined from rcwv= power rating re sis tance values, or limiting element voltage list ed above, whichever less. (2) overload (short-time overload) test voltage (sotv) shall be de termined from sotv=2.5 (only erj2rk 1% =2.0) power rating or max. over load volt age list ed above whichever less. (3) please contact us when you need a type with a resistance of less than 10 . part no.
